Deborah Carol Sheldon (Miller), 61, of Opelika died suddenly on July 26, 2024. Born in Burlington, Vermont, December 21, 1962, Deborah has been a proud Alabamian for well over 40 years. Preceded in death by her father, Carlton Willard Sheldon, and her mother, Rosa Leona Whatley, siblings: John David Hickman, Rosa Mae Hickman, Jacqueline Garrow, Carl Sheldon Jr., Dale Sheldon, Doris Sheldon, Margaret Garrow; and her faithful companion “Jade”.
Deborah is survived by Carl “Andy” (Piedad) Garrow, Gail (Robert) Spratlin, Susan Sheldon, Darling (Arthur) Marshall, Darrel (Lisa) Sheldon, Steven (Nannette) Sheldon, William Spratlin and Sharron Sheldon, as well as an entire host of nieces and nephews that she loved as her own children.
Deborah was a cosmetologist and later went on to nursing school where she explored her love of helping and caring for others. After early medical retirement, Deborah spent her time crafting and being creative, much like her Dad. She also had his quick wit and sense of humor, and loving all the children in her life much like her mom.
Deborah was a beloved sister and Aunt and she will be missed immeasurably.
The family is holding a Celebration of Life ceremony at Little Texas Community Church and Tabernacle in Tuskegee, Alabama. Services starting August 17, 2024 at 11:00 am CST.
Lunch will be provided by the family following the service.
The family asks that all in attendance dress comfortably.
